AUXILIARY POWER CONNECTIONS

The Precision TIG machines provide a standard NEMA

5-15R duplex receptacle, located on the upper case

back on the torch side of the machine:

• The bottom outlet of this duplex receptacle provides

switched 115VAC power for the Under-Cooler, or

Water Solenoid accessory. This Cooler receptacle

turns on when the arc starts and remains on for about

8 minutes after the arc goes out (with the Fan-As-

Needed machine cooling fan, see Maintenance

Section), so the Cooler’s fan and water pump will not

run continuously in idle, but will run while welding.

• The top outlet of this duplex receptacle provides at

least 8 amps at 115VAC, whenever the Precision TIG

Power switch is ON. This auxiliary circuit is intended

for running 115VAC accessories or small power tools.

Note: Some types of equipment, especially pumps

and large motors, have starting currents which are

significantly higher than their running current. These

higher starting currents may cause the circuit breaker

to open. (See next paragraph)

• Both the receptacle circuits are protected from shorts

and overloads by a 15 amp circuit breaker, located

above the receptacle. If the breaker trips, its button

pops out exposing a red ring. When the circuit break-

er cools, the button can be reset by pressing it back

in.

Note: When the breaker trips, not only will the auxil-

iary and cooler power be interrupted, but so will the

power to the shielding gas solenoid and machine

cooling fan.

The Precision TIG Export models also provide a

grounded 220vac Euro type Schuko receptacle and a

5 amp circuit breaker, located on the upper case back

on the reconnect side of the machine, intended for use

with a 220vac water cooler.

REMOTE CONTROL (If Used)

The Foot Amptrol or other Remote accessory, is

installed by routing the plug of its control cable up

through the left cable strain relief hole provided in the

base (see Figure A.2), then connecting the 6-pin plug

to the mating Remote receptacle behind the stud panel

cover. (See Operation Section B-2 for mating plug

wiring.)

Note: If the Precision TIG is equipped with an Under-

Cooler or Under-Storage unit, the Foot Pedal (or other

remote control accessory) and coiled control cable, or

excess cable length, may be conveniently stored in the

drawer while remaining connected.
